什么是阿里云,云服务器便宜的

文章 3年前 (2021) admin
0
什么是阿里云,云服务器便宜的

Q1:阿里云服务器如何安装memcached

方法/步骤1使用Xshell登录阿里巴巴云服务器1请使用根帐户登录2以下操作都在主目录中执行32安装libevent4输入命令yum-y install libevent-dev 3下载memcached源代码并解压缩5输入命令wget-c tar-zxvf memcached-1 . 4 . 18 . tar . gzcd memcached-1 . 4 . 184来指定memcached安装路径6输入命令7/configure-prefix=/alidata/server/memcached/5进行编译和安装8输入命令make make install6来修改memcached的用户组9通常,应用服务器将由一个用户运行10如果使用阿里巴巴云的一键安装包部署环境,应用服务器的用户是www11现在将memcached文件夹分配给www,并输入命令:chown -R 7,将memcached设置为启动时自动启动12要自动启动memcached,您需要向/etc/init.d添加一个服务脚本,memcached的源包已经包含了一个服务脚本,但是需要稍加修改才能使用13输入命令:CP ~/memcached-1 . 4 . 18/scripts/memcached . sysv/etc/init . d/memcached VI/etc/init . d/memcached修改图中红框内容14参数描述如下:PORT=11211 #被监控端口用户www #所属用户MAXCONN=1024 #最大连接数CACHESIZE=64 #已用内存大小,这里是64MOPTIONS=" " #其他选项15start()函数修改如下:start(){ echo-n $ " starting $ Prog : " #确保/var/run/memcached具有适当的权限# chown $ USER/var/run/memcached/alidata/server/memcached/bin/memcached-d-P $ PORT-u $ USER-m $ CACHESIZE-c $ MAXCONN-P/alidata/server/memcached/memcached . PID $ options retval=$?echo[$ RETVAL-eq 0]touch/var/lock/subsys/memcached }

Q2:阿里云linux服务器怎么配置memcache

1.什么是memcachememcache是一个高性能的分布式内存对象缓存系统16通过在内存中维护一个统一的巨大哈希表,它可以用来存储各种格式的数据,包括图像、视频、文件和数据库检索的结果172.libevent简介libevent是一个事件触发的网络库,适用于windows、linux、bsd等平台,内部使用select、epoll、kqueue等系统调用和管理事件18Memcached是apache著名的php缓存库,据说也是基于libevent的19此外,libevent可以跨平台使用203.准备工作下载:memcache:http://www.danga.com/memcached/dist/memcached-1.2.2.tar.gz下载:http://www.monkey.org/~provos/libevent-1.3.tar.gz 421安装过程122卸载较低版本的libevent # ls-al/usr/lib | Grep libevent lrwxrwx 1根libevent-1.1a . so . 1-libevent-1.1a.so.1.0.2-rwxr-xr-x1根libevent-1.1a . so . 1 . 0 . 2检查当前的libevent版本23如果版本低于1.3,建议卸载# rpm-e libevent-nodeps卸载libevent,再次查看#ls -al /usr/lib |grep libevent24卸载成功225安装libevent # tar zxvf libevent-1.3.tar.gz并解压缩libevent # CD libevent-1.3 #26/configure-prefix=/usr # make # make install配置并安装libevent到# ls-al/usr/lib | grep libevent lrwxrwx 1 root 21 11?12 17:38 libevent-1 . 2 . so . 1-libevent-1 . 2 . so . 1 . 0 . 3-rwxr-xr-x 1根根263546 11?12 17:38 libevent-1 . 2 . so . 1 . 0 . 3-rw-rr1根根454156 11?12 17:38 libevent . a-rwxr-xr-x 1根根811 11?12 17:38 libevent . lalrwxrwxrwx 1 root 21 11?2 17:38 libevent1.3 so-libevent-1 . 2 . so . 1 . 0 . 3再次检查,libevent 1.3版本安装成功273.安装memcached28同时,您需要将安装# tar zxvf memcached-1.2.6.tar.gz # CD memcached-1 . 2 . 6中指定的libevent的安装位置提取到mamcache目录#29/configure-with-libevent=/usr/# make #30Make install将把memcached放入/usr/local/bin/memcached # ls-al/usr/local/bin/memcached-rwxr-xr-x1rootrout 137986 11?117:39/usr/local/bin/memcached检查memcached是否已成功安装315.memcached的基本设置#/usr/local/bin/memcached-d-m 2000-uroot-p 12000-c256-p ./memcached . PID 1 .启动memcached的服务器端:#/usr/local/bin/memcached-d-m 10-uroot-l 192 . 168 . 0 . 200-p 12000-c 256-p/tmp/memcached . PID-d选项是启动一个守护进程32-m是分配给Memcache的内存量,单位为MB,这里我是10MB33-u是运行Memcache的用户,我是这里的root34-l是要监听的服务器的IP地址35如果有多个地址,我在这里指定了服务器的IP地址为192.168.0.20036-p是设置Memcache监听的端口,我这里设置了1200037端口最好在1024以上38-c选项是运行的最大并发连接数,默认值为102439我这里设置了256,是根据你服务器的负载来设置的40-P是保存memcached的pid文件,我保存在/tmp/memcached.pid中,我也可以启动多个守护进程,但是端口不能重复416.客户测试142下载Java _ memcached-release _ 2 . 5 . 1 . zip 2,创建一个Java项目,参考Java _ memcached-release _ 2 . 5 . 1 . jar包433.在主函数中,创建两个类,分别为package com . danga . memcached;导入Java . io . serializable;导入com . danga . memcached . memcached client;导入com . danga . memcached . sockiopol;公共类TestObj实现了Serializable { private static final long serialVersionUID = 1L; private String name; private Long id; public TestObj() { } public Long getId() { return id; } public void setId(Long id) { this.id = id; } public String getName() { return name; } public void setName(String name) { this.name = name; } public String toString() { return "id:"+this.getId()+";name:"+this.getName(); } }package com.danga.MemCached;import java.io.Serializable; import com.danga.MemCached.MemCachedClient; import com.danga.MemCached.SockIOPool; public class MemcacheTest{ //create a static client as most installs only need //a single instance protected static MemCachedClient mcc = new MemCachedClient(); //set up connection pool once at class load static { //server list and weights String[] servers ={"192.168.0.226:12000"}; Integer[] weights = { 3 }; //grab an instance of our connection pool SockIOPool pool = SockIOPool.getInstance(); //set the servers and the weights pool.setServers( servers ); pool.setWeights( weights ); //set some basic pool settings //5 initial, 5 min, and 250 max conns //and set the max idle time for a conn //to 6 hours pool.setInitConn( 5 ); pool.setMinConn( 5 ); pool.setMaxConn( 250 ); pool.setMaxIdle( 1000 * 60 * 60 * 6 ); //set the sleep for the maint thread //it will wake up every x seconds and //maintain the pool size pool.setMaintSleep( 30 ); //set some TCP settings //disable nagle //set the read timeout to 3 secs //and don"t set a connect timeout pool.setNagle( false ); pool.setSocketTO( 3000 ); pool.setSocketConnectTO( 0 ); //initialize the connection pool pool.initialize(); //lets set some compression on for the client //compress anything larger than 64k mcc.setCompressEnable( true ); mcc.setCompressThreshold( 64 * 1024 ); } public static void bulidCache() { mcc.set( "foo", "This is a test String" ); TestObj obj = new TestObj(); obj.setId(new Long(1)); obj.setName("test"); mcc.set("testObj", obj); } //from here on down, you can call any of the client calls public static void output() { // String bar = (String) mcc.get( "foo" ); System.out.println(bar); TestObj obj = (TestObj)mcc.get("testObj"); System.out.println("ID : "+obj.getId()+"\n"+"Name : "+obj.getName()); } public static void main(String[] args) { bulidCache(); output(); } } 4、运行结果This is a test StringID : 1Name : testmemcache配置成功~~~~~~~~~~~~~~~~~~~~

Q3:Memcached 如何设置比较好?Linux 服务器中宝塔面板

配置修改:如果不懂代码的话,不要伸手,后果自负44负载状态:memcached运行中的相关状态45其中最重要的是hit这个参数,也就是命中率46当然是越高越好了47性能调整:前面IP和端口不要改48缓存大小根据实际情况调整49根据什么来调整呢?回到负载状态栏,有一个“当前已使用内存”,看这个数字来调整50比如默认分配给memcached一共64M内存,但是已使用内存62M就说明memcached可用内存快要满了,这时候就手动改大一点,比如128M51具体数字根据每天流量情况来定52Memcached的目的就是把所有文章内容都扔进内存,这样用户来访时直接读取内存中的内容,跳过了数据库,所以使用memcached后网站打开感觉特别快53比如网站每天发几十篇文章,可能这个数字就调整大一点,防止不够用了

Q4:Thinkphp框架使用阿里云的memcached,我怎么也连不上

如果Memcache没有启用的框架也没关系54win环境与linux有些不同55检查自己的配置,做好以防万一56

Q5:我要用阿里云的memcache缓存微信的access token ,需要本地电脑配置一下吗?

不需要5758596061626364656667686970

Q6:阿里云数据库redis怎么配置

根据下面步骤创建适应业务需求的云数据库Redis版实例http://redoufu.com/。使用下列方法中任意一种打开购买页:打开云数据库Redis版产品首页,单击立即购买72说明 如果尚未登录阿里云账号,单击立即购买后需要先使用阿里云账号和密码登录73登录Redis管理控制台,单击右上角的创建实例74设置以下参数75选择密码设置方式76立即设置:在下方的输入密码区域设置密码77稍后设置:创建实例后再修改密码78设置实例名称、购买数量,如果创建包年包月实例,还需设置时长79在确认订单页,阅读《云数据库KVStore版服务协议》,确认接受后在服务协议前的选框中单击勾选80单击去开通81因为这方面内容较多,这里也写不开那么多内容,所以你可以留言或到我的博客搜索相关内容,老魏有写过教程,还不止一篇,都挺详细的内容,可以帮助你入门82

版权声明:admin 发表于 2021年10月27日 下午7:23。
转载请注明:什么是阿里云,云服务器便宜的 | 热豆腐网址之家

相关文章